Foro de elhacker.net

Programación => Java => Mensaje iniciado por: Skar.2007 en 31 Marzo 2015, 02:40 am



Título: RMI: Conexión Cliente-Servidor
Publicado por: Skar.2007 en 31 Marzo 2015, 02:40 am
Java JDK 7.0 / Eclipse Kepler

Hola a todos

Para generar un Proyecto RMI, ¿es necesario tener instalado el Complemento WebTools en Eclipse o es posible realizar el enlace entre Servidor y Cliente tanto en Máquinas Virtuales como en Máquinas Físicas de una forma diferente y óptima?

Desde ya Muchísimas Gracias


Título: Re: RMI: Conexión Cliente-Servidor
Publicado por: Usuario Invitado en 31 Marzo 2015, 03:26 am
No creo que sea necesario, ya que no usa directamente algún elemento destinado a la comuniación web. Con Eclipse for Java basta, pero te recomiendo descargarte Eclipse for Java EE ya que en el futuro, vas a trabajar con Servlets, WebServices, en fin, desarrollo web en general, que es en lo que más se usa Java.


Saludos.


Título: Re: RMI: Conexión Cliente-Servidor
Publicado por: Skar.2007 en 31 Marzo 2015, 05:37 am
Gracias Gus Garsaky

Ahora de ser posible dónde puedo conseguir un ejemplo o si tienes algo simple implementado para servir de guía sería excelente.

Desde ya Muchísimas Gracias


Título: Re: RMI: Conexión Cliente-Servidor
Publicado por: Usuario Invitado en 31 Marzo 2015, 15:24 pm
Busca en google y te saldran muchos ejemplos tanto en inglés como en español.

No suelo usar RMI porque para aplicaciones donde habrá mucha comunicación no tiene buen rendimiento; la razón es porque para cada nueva llamada al servidor se crea un nuevo thread y, si la aplicación hace numerosas llamadas, el resultado será un número grande de threads que como sabemos, consumen memoria.

Si éste es tu caso, me inclinaría por sockets asíncronos. Mucho más eficiente.


Un saludo.